According to Pauling's scale, hydrogen has an electronegativity of 2.1 and Cl has 3.0. This difference makes the H-Cl bond polar by the attraction of bonding electrons towards chlorine.
Hydrogen chloride (HCl) is a polar covalent molecule because it has a significant difference in electronegativity between the hydrogen and chlorine atoms. Chlorine is more electronegative, meaning it has a stronger attraction for electrons, causing the shared electron pair between hydrogen and chlorine to be unequally shared. As a result, the chlorine atom acquires a partial negative charge, while the hydrogen atom acquires a partial positive charge. This uneven distribution of charge creates a dipole moment, making HCl a polar covalent molecule.

If Hydrogen gas is chemically combined with Chlorine gas, Hydrogen chloride is formed: H2 (g) + Cl2 (g) ---> 2 HCl (g) The bond is covalent (the atoms share electrons) and polar (Chlorine is more electronegative). Hydrogen chloride gas will dissolve in water and disassociate into ions: HCl ---> H+ (aq) + Cl- (aq)
Hydrogen chloride is covalent in pure form but ionizes when it dissolves in water.
